Class SI (Semi-Integrated) — Best For

Class SI (Semi-Integrated) motorhomes are an excellent all-around choice for families of 3-4, offering a superb balance of interior comfort and external maneuverability for Dutch roads. Bandana's Amsterdam fleet of Class SI motorhomes averages 7 meters in length and comfortably sleeps up to 4 people. These modern vehicles blend the driving cab with the living area, creating a more streamlined and fuel-efficient profile than their Class C counterparts.

With an average fuel consumption of 10–11 Liters/100 km, they are well-suited for both city-adjacent camping and longer trips through the countryside. This class is ideal for families who want modern amenities like a full kitchen and bathroom without the bulk of a much larger vehicle. The balance they strike makes them our top recommendation for most family travelers. Class C (Alcove) — Best For

Class C (Alcove) motorhomes are the go-to option for larger families or groups of 4-6 people who need the maximum amount of sleeping space on a budget. These vehicles are easily recognizable by the signature alcove or "cab-over" bunk that sits above the driver's cabin, providing an extra double bed without sacrificing living space. In Amsterdam, our available Class C motorhomes average 7.2 meters in length and can sleep an average of 5.9 people.

This class is the workhorse of family RV rentals, offering generous interior layouts, ample storage, and full-featured kitchens and bathrooms. While their larger profile means slightly higher fuel consumption (typically 10–12 Liters/100 km) and requires a bit more care when navigating, their value is unmatched for accommodating more people comfortably. Class B (Campervan) — Best For

Class B motorhomes, often called campervans, are the most compact and agile option, making them perfect for couples or small families of up to 3 people. These vehicles are built within the frame of a standard van, and our Amsterdam fleet averages just 5.9 meters in length. Their smaller size makes them incredibly easy to drive and park, allowing you to navigate both bustling cities and narrow country lanes with confidence.

What they lack in space, they make up for in efficiency and convenience. With the best fuel economy of all motorhome classes (averaging 8-10 Liters/100 Km), a rented campervan is a smart choice for the budget-conscious traveler. They cleverly pack in all the essentials, including a small kitchen, a convertible sleeping area, and often a compact wet bath (toilet/shower combo). If you prioritize easy driving and a more minimalist travel style, a Class B campervan is your ideal companion for exploring Amsterdam and beyond.

Is the Netherlands motorhome friendly?

Yes, the Netherlands is a very motorhome-friendly country, boasting excellent road infrastructure and a dense network of high-quality campgrounds and dedicated RV service points. While major city centers like Amsterdam present challenges for parking and driving larger vehicles, the country as a whole is well-equipped for RV travel. The strategy is simple: stay at well-connected campsites on the city outskirts and use the superb public transport to explore urban areas.

Dutch roads are well-maintained, though you should be prepared for narrower streets in historic towns. The real key to a smooth trip is embracing the Dutch way of life: travel slowly, with an average of 100-150 km per day, giving you plenty of time to enjoy the scenery. Be mindful of the country's many cyclists and environmental zones (Milieuzones) in larger cities. Is it cheaper to rent an RV or stay in a hotel?

For families, renting an RV in the Netherlands is often significantly more cost-effective than staying in hotels, especially for trips longer than a week. A rented motorhome combines your accommodation, transportation, and kitchen into one package, creating substantial savings. While a hotel requires separate costs for rooms (often multiple for a family), a rental car, and dining out for every meal, an RV rental consolidates these expenses.

The ability to prepare your own meals is one of the biggest financial advantages. Imagine waking up and making a fresh breakfast right at your campsite instead of paying for four or more people at a café. What You Shouldn't Miss

With a rented motorhome, Amsterdam is your launchpad to a world of Dutch wonders. Here are a few experiences you won't want to miss:

  • Keukenhof Gardens: If you're visiting in the spring, a day trip to the world's most beautiful spring garden is an absolute must. Park your RV nearby and immerse yourselves in millions of tulips.
  • Zaanse Schans: Experience a picture-perfect Dutch village complete with historic windmills, wooden houses, and artisan workshops. It's an easy drive from Amsterdam and has dedicated parking.
  • De Hoge Veluwe National Park: Combine nature, art, and cycling in one of the Netherlands' largest national parks. Use the free white bicycles to explore the diverse landscapes and visit the Kröller-Müller Museum, home to a world-class Van Gogh collection.
  • The Delta Works: Witness one of the modern wonders of the world, a massive system of dams and storm surge barriers in Zeeland province. It's a testament to Dutch engineering and resilience.
  • Giethoorn Village: Known as the "Venice of the North," this charming village has no roads. Park your motorhome and explore its canals by boat for a truly unique experience.

Where can I park a rented RV near Amsterdams city center

Direct parking in Amsterdams center is not feasible for motorhomes The best strategy is to stay at a campground on the outskirts such as Camping Zeeburg or Camping Vliegenbos which offer excellent and quick public transport connections into the heart of the city

Do I need to worry about Low Emission Zones Milieuzones with a rented motorhome in Amsterdam

For the most part no Rental motorhomes are typically modern vehicles that meet the Euro 4 or higher emission standards required to enter Amsterdams Low Emission Zone However it is always a good practice to confirm the vehicles specifics with the rental supplier upon pickup
